Is Ladybug Espresso clean?
Ladybug Espresso is currently Rated Okay from Public Health β Seattle & King County, from an inspection on January 6, 2025. Inspectors wrote up 2 critical violations β the kind most directly linked to foodborne illness. On Cooked's ladder that reads mid π¬.

How Seattle grades restaurants
Public Health β Seattle & King County posts a word, not a letter: Excellent, Good, Okay, or Needs To Improve. The rating is deliberately not a snapshot β it averages the establishmentβs recent routine inspections, so one bad day does not sink a consistently clean kitchen and one good day does not rescue a bad one. Inspectors score violations in red points for things that directly cause foodborne illness and blue points for everything else; around 45 red points triggers a mandatory re-inspection. Newly opened or recently changed spots can show as Not Rated until enough inspections accumulate.
